The first step in the transfer involved pumping the water down enough so the pond could be seined. I started the night before and pumped it down 10" just to see the rate of drop. My plan was to start pumping at 8am the next morning. When I got up it was 26 degrees outside and decided to wait till 7am to start pumping. I should have pumped a little more the night before and started a little earlier. We ended up an hour or two of waiting to pump more water out of the pond. This is my first time of doing such a thing. I'll have a better idea of how much to pump if I do it again. 3" trash pump.

While we were waiting the cast net became a popular pass time and a number of HSB and RES were captured and transferred to my main pond.
